TapTap

Games worth discovering

iconicon
Phantom Blade Zero
icon
I see this...-CheeryTurtle's Posts - TapTap

3 View2025-10-20
I see this game in YouTube..I'm interested to try this game .
Mentioned games
iconView desktop site

TapTap looks better

on the app love-tato

Open with TapTap